19th Century Toleware Grocer’s Shop Tea Tin

About the Item

19th century toleware grocer’s shop tea tin, A beautiful decorative Grocers Tea Canister, it would have been filled with Tea for sale, it has a very attractive style. The lid is made in wood, it has TEA carved on it and the hinged top is sloped from where it would have been filled The toleware has the number 19 on the front and it looks in quite good condition, however some of the tin on the bottom has a few holes, this could be sorted with placing a liner on the inside The Caddy is 16” high and 11”x 11” deep AC264.
